The value of crafts in Bible teaching
- Makes learning fun
- Makes a lesson memorable and lasting
- Helps illustrate a truth and enables better understanding
- Builds self-confidence
- Instills a sense of achievement
- Encourages self-expression and creativity
- Teaches cooperation through the sharing of resources
- Builds relationships by providing opportunity to help others
- Allows for a meaningful, relevant change of activity
General safety awareness
Provide only child-friendly (round nose) scissors
- Never leave craft knives lying around
- Use only non-toxic paints and glue
- Use spray paints outdoors or in a well-ventilated area
- Be careful with drawing pins as they often land on the floor, facing up
- Ensure that there is adequate supervision
